Authenticity Of Tirmidhi Hadith: 3521?

What is the authenticity of the following narration:- > Abu Umamah narrated: > > “The Messenger of Allah (ﷺ) supplicated with many supplications of > which we did not preserve a thing. We said: ‘O Messenger of Allah, you > supplicated with many supplications of which we did not preserve a > thing.’ He (ﷺ) said: ‘Should I not direct you to what will include all > of that? That you say: O Allah, we ask You from the good of what Your > Prophet Muhammad (ﷺ) asked You for, and we seek refuge in You from the > evil of that which Your Prophet Muhammad (ﷺ) sought refuge in You > from, and You are the one from Whom aid is sought, and it is for You > to fulfill, and there is no might or power except by Allah." (Jami` > at-Tirmidhi 3521) I found this narration in book of Adhkar I have, but when I checked it on Sunnah.com, I saw that it was marked as "Daif".
